How to Subscribe

An RSS feed is a standard, machine-readable format that notifies the reader whenever new content is published. You do not need an account; simply add the feed URL to any reader. Here are popular options:

Step-by-step

  1. Copy the feed URL, for example, https://abdullahfirm.com/feeds/all.xml.
  2. Open the RSS reader and choose Add feed or Subscribe.
  3. Paste the URL and confirm. The reader will fetch the feed and list every item.
  4. New articles will appear in the reader automatically, usually within an hour of publication.

Feed Format

Our feeds use RSS 2.0 with Dublin Core extensions (dc:creator) and an Atom self-link (atom:link rel="self"). Each item includes a title, canonical link, unique GUID, publication date in RFC-822 format, author, description, and categories. This is compatible with every major RSS reader published in the last twenty years.
